> CD Creator that comes with a drive is usually CD Creator 3.5 (not
> the deluxe
> version of it) and it does not have the software to backup a hard drive on
> multiple CD(s). I believe that the deluxe version of 3.5 and I am
> definitely
> sure that version 4.0 has the ability to do what you need. I know that
> version 4.0 includes an application called Take Two. Hope that helps.

I have Version 4.0 and I consider Take Two to be a horrible backup
program. I am in the process of trying a number of CD-R/W backup
programs and I am not thrilled with any of them. You can download
a 30 day trial of version of Backup Exec from www.veritas.com that
is fairly decent (big brother to MS Backup). I would be interested
in what other people are using for a CD-R/W backup program.
